Can Macor be joined? Macor can be linked and joined with many different methods. Whether it is metalized (metal inks or sputtering) it might be soldered, or brazed to other items, or sure to steel parts including titanium during the picture to the right. Epoxy delivers a strong joint and sealing glass supplies a hermetic seal.

Other than its thermal growth coefficient and electrical insulation capabilities, aluminum nitride ceramics are resistant to attacks by most molten metals, like copper, lithium, and aluminum. These, in combination with a number of other chemical and physical Qualities, make aluminum nitride a helpful materials in many industrial applications.
